Web中CSS樣式應用解析
在現(xiàn)代Web開發(fā)中,CSS(層疊樣式表)扮演著***關(guān)重要的角色,它為網(wǎng)頁賦予了豐富的視覺表現(xiàn)和優(yōu)雅的布局,本文將簡要介紹在Web中如何應用CSS樣式,以及相關(guān)的核心概念和技巧。
一、CSS概述
CSS是一種用于描述網(wǎng)頁樣式和布局的語言,通過CSS,***可以控制網(wǎng)頁中元素的外觀、位置、大小等視覺表現(xiàn),在Web項目中,CSS通常與HTML結(jié)合使用,共同構(gòu)建頁面的結(jié)構(gòu)和內(nèi)容。
二、CSS樣式的引入方式
在Web項目中引入CSS樣式主要有三種方式:
1、內(nèi)聯(lián)樣式:直接在HTML元素中使用style
屬性添加樣式。
2、外部樣式表:在獨立的CSS文件中編寫樣式,通過HTML的<link>
標簽引入。
3、導入樣式表:使用@import
規(guī)則在CSS文件中引入其他樣式表。
三、CSS選擇器與規(guī)則
CSS通過選擇器來選擇要應用樣式的HTML元素,常見的選擇器包括:
1、元素選擇器:根據(jù)HTML元素類型選擇,如div
、p
等。
2、類選擇器:通過類屬性選擇,如.myClass
。
3、ID選擇器:選擇具有特定ID的元素,如#myID
。
每條CSS規(guī)則由選擇器和聲明塊組成,聲明塊包含一條或多條聲明,每條聲明由屬性和值構(gòu)成。
四、布局與定位
CSS提供了多種布局和定位方法,如盒模型、流式布局、定位等,***可以通過這些方法控制元素的位置、大小以及與其他元素的關(guān)系。
五、***特性
除了基本的樣式和布局功能外,CSS還提供了許多***特性,如動畫、漸變、陰影等,這些特性可以進一步增強網(wǎng)頁的視覺效果和用戶體驗。
六、***佳實踐
在Web開發(fā)中應用CSS時,應遵循一些***佳實踐,如保持樣式表的簡潔、使用語義化的類名、避免使用內(nèi)聯(lián)樣式等,以提高代碼的可維護性和可復用性。
CSS是Web開發(fā)中不可或缺的一部分,掌握CSS的應用和相關(guān)知識對于構(gòu)建現(xiàn)代網(wǎng)頁***關(guān)重要,通過不斷學習和實踐,***可以不斷提升自己在CSS領(lǐng)域的技能,為Web世界創(chuàng)造更多精彩的視覺體驗。